The Geneva Classics is a new show combining classic cars, bikes, boats, buses, and aircraft, and as a guy who loves all types of historic transport, it looks like my kind of party. Also included is an exhibition of automobilia and other fascinating transport goodies, a drive-in cinema featuring a selection of films devoted to period transport (which you can watch from the seat of your classic automobile), and a classic sports car auction. If, by good fortune, you're in the neighbourhood from October 6th through the 8th, you'll find Geneva Classics at PalExpo, within walking distance of the Geneva international airport
. The historic aircraft will, obviously, be exhibited on the apron of the airport.
